Michigan´s Smokefree Law (P.A. 188)
On May 1, 2010, Michigan residents and visitors became protected from exposure to
secondhand tobacco smoke in restaurants, bars and businesses (including hotels and motels),
thanks to the Dr. Ron Davis Smoke-free Air Law.
Exemptions to this law include gaming floors of the 3 Detroit casinos, existing cigar bars
and tobacco specialty shops.
